Disable automatic execution in Windows Vista

At each opening of CD or DVD, USB keys, digital cameras, flash cards or other removable media, Windows automatically displays a window depending on the content present on the support newly inserted. Each type of content (movies, pictures, games, etc..) Is associated with one or several specific actions between which you can choose the one to make - unless an automatic action has been defined by default. Useful at first sight, this feature can quickly seem invasive! Plus for a long time after reading this tip.

To disable the automatic execution of Vista, you just have to go to the Control Panel and then open Read CDs or other media automatically under and audio equipment.

You then have the choice to disable it for certain types of media or all:

  • Case No. 1: uncheck the Use automatic execution for all media and all peripherals;
  • Case No. 2: For the medium of your choice, pull down the list and select Do nothing.

To complete the transaction, click Save.

Now your devices can automatically launch a particular application, nor does it ask to choose an action.
